  • Abstract
    This experimental study is focused on the application of some nature inspired classifier ensembles for the detection of SNMP-related attacks. The reliability of the novel method proposed is compared with other models and validated under a real interesting case study, taking into account several different anomalous situations as port scan and MIB Information Transfer.
